Highlights
Are people in Rumson older or younger than people in Mercer Island?
- The Median Age in Rumson is 2.8 years younger than in Mercer Island.

Are housing costs cheaper in Rumson or Mercer Island?
- Rumson housing costs are 23.0% less expensive than Mercer Island hous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Rumson or Mercer Island?
- The average commute for residents of Rumson is 19.7 minutes longer than it is for residents of Mercer Island.

Things to do in Mercer Island?
Mercer Island, Washington is a vibrant city located in King County and renowned for its lush parks and nature reserves, thriving restaurants, and small-town charm. It offers plenty of activities for outdoor enthusiasts to enjoy, from exploring Luther Burbank Park to kayaking on Lake Washington. Visitors can also explore local attractions such as the Mercer Island Historical Society or shop at nearby malls such as Bellevue Square. With easy access to Seattle and other major cities like Redmond and Kirkland, Mercer Island makes an ideal destination for visitors seeking an unforgettable experience close to urban amenities.
